    In the 2025 elections, voters will choose who will fill more than 18,000 local positions: (Provinces) 82 governors, 82 vice governors, 840 board members; (Cities) 149 mayors, 149 vice mayors, 1,690 councilors; (Municipalities) 1,493 mayors, 1,493 vice mayors, 11,948 councilors; 254 representatives; (BARMM Parliament) 65 members, party representatives.

    Sugbongcogon


    April 2025

    Sugbongcogon is a 5th-class municipality in the Philippines. It is part of Misamis Oriental in Northern Mindanao, located in Mindanao. It has a population of 9,764 as of the 2020 Census, and a land area of 26.50 square kilometers. It consists of 10 barangays. In the 2025 elections, the municipality has 9,758 registered voters.
